About Deguo Wang

Deguo Wang is a scholar working on Metals and Alloys, Mechanical Engineering, Mechanics of Materials, Ocean Engineering and Surfaces, Coatings and Films, having authored 216 papers that have together received 3.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lubricants and Their Additives (26 papers), Tribology and Wear Analysis (26 papers), Biosensors and Analytical Detection (20 papers), Identification and Quantification in Food (14 papers), Mechanical stress and fatigue analysis (12 papers), Structural Integrity and Reliability Analysis (12 papers), Adhesion, Friction, and Surface Interactions (11 papers) and Drilling and Well Engineering (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Metals and Alloys (112 citations), Mechanics of Materials (782 citations), Mechanical Engineering (1.1k citations), Ocean Engineering (389 citations) and Civil and Structural Engineering (434 citations). Deguo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Ireland. Frequent co-authors include Yanbao Guo, Shuhai Liu, Quan Xu, Renyang He, Tao Meng, Peggy M. Tomasula, Moushumi Paul, Jeffrey D. Brewster, Siwei Zhang and Xiaoxiao Zhu. Their work appears in journals such as Tribology International, Wear, Tribology Letters, Journal of Natural Gas Science and Engineering and Measurement.
